Jump to content

    

initfamfs - busybox - kernel

Вот я смотрю в своем ядре (2.6.34), тэги для рамдиска только для ARM и реализованы, больше нигде нет.

 

Какой вообще статус этого кода? Вот я залез в git для ядра 3.10, там организация исходного кода тэгов отличается от того, что есть у меня.

(https://git.kernel.org/cgit/linux/kernel/git/stable/linux-stable.git/tree/arch/arm/kernel?id=refs/tags/v3.10.24)

 

например, в 2.6.34 еще есть какие-то намеки на работу с тегами для c6x, а в 3.10 там уже ничего нет, во всяком случае в setup_arch никаких намеков не осталось.

Edited by Hoodwin

Share this post


Link to post
Share on other sites

Вполне может быть, что и не прижилось. Я работаю в основном с армами. Есть архитектуры, где исторически параметры ядру передаются по-другому.

Share this post


Link to post
Share on other sites

Ладно, пока решил перенести код с армов, там вполне себе развитый набор тегов как в ядре, так и в u-boot.

 

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this